As an Operations Assistant, you’ll help keep the yard clean, safe and running smoothly while making sure customers get friendly, reliable service. You’ll be part of a supportive team that works together to keep things moving and make every customer’s experience a good one.
What You’ll Be Doing
Pick orders across carcassing, sheets, joinery, and PAR - accurately and efficiently
Keep the yard clean, tidy and well-organised, with stock clearly labelled
Flag low stock levels to the team
Help out with general housekeeping to keep the space safe and neat
Operate forklifts safely and responsibly, following all health and safety guidelines
Assist with picking and loading company vehicles when needed
Communicate with the team to keep things running smoothly
Jump in with any other tasks that help get the job done

About Disability Confident
A Disability Confident employer will generally offer an interview to any applicant that declares they have a disability and meets the minimum criteria for the job as defined by the employer. It is important to note that in certain recruitment situations such as high-volume, seasonal and high-peak times, the employer may wish to limit the overall numbers of interviews offered to both disabled people and non-disabled people.
